BIO:
Coach Sam Poole was born in Enterprise, Alabama, and raised throughout the South in a military family. Athletics became a grounding force for him early on, ultimately leading to standout high school careers in both basketball and football. His dedication earned him a full Division I scholarship to Southeast Missouri State University, where he played four years as a strong safety and outside linebacker.
Sam holds a Bachelor of Science in Exercise Science and a Master’s degree in Sports and Health Science, equipping him with a deep understanding of training science, biomechanics, and long-term athletic development. After completing his education, he began his coaching career at D1 Sports Training in Tampa, working his way from intern to coach. Over the past decade, he has coached thousands of sessions, trained athletes at every level, owned and worked in multiple gyms, and built a reputation for delivering high-quality, intentional programming.
